The 20-year-old 'We Can't Stop' singer is currently in London to promote her new single and she was amused when she was offered a surprising proposition by a bold fan, who was keen to catch her attention, reported Contactmusic.
"Someone tried to bribe me yesterday. I was walking to my hotel and one of my fans said very much the same thing. They wanted to come up, come hang," Cyrus said.
"I was like, 'We've gotta go inside! We've gotta go inside!' They were like, 'We've got cigarettes and Sour Patch Kids'," she added.
"I'm probably just gonna lay in bed, try to catch up and do some shopping. I've got my friends here, one of my friends has never been here before.
"So, I want to take them to the London Eye, and wanna go walk around a little bit. I only want to see inside of stores but I feel like I should take him to go see something," Cyrus said.
